Faculty Services Library Liaison Program

Collaborating with You in the Learning Process

The liaison program is the main vehicle for communication and collaboration between librarians and faculty. The goals of the liaison program are to:

  1. inform faculty of new print and on-line resources pertinent to classroom instruction
  2. help faculty develop high-quality collections in their subject areas
  3. keep faculty informed about programs and services which impact their departments
  4. assist faculty with their personal research
  5. teach tailored research sessions upon request
  6. address library-related questions and concerns
